O. P. T. WHISKEY / SPRUANCE STANLEY & CO. / S.F.

         ID#: KWS798

Glass Category:Liquor advertising
Glass Type:Barrel, heavy base
Label Type:Usual white-etched label
Dimensions:*2-1/4" x 1-15/16" x 1-1/2"
Edmonson:OASG, p. 145, entry #1
State:CA
City:San Francisco
Notes:
Spruance, Stanley & Co. listed from 1867-1906.

*Glass measurements have not been confirmed.



"S L Stanley, John Spruance and C C Chapman. Successors to H Webster & Co. and J & J Spruance." (display ad. Note the former business ceases listing in 1872 and the new company shows up at the Webster address).

According to the Wilsons, J & J Spruance established a company in 1868 that survived until 1872. John Spruance then partnered with Samuel L Stanley to create Spruance, Stanley & Co. C C Chapman was included in the "Co." according to an invoice dated 1876.

Thomas (WBOW) suggests that Aaron H Powers also served as a third partner and that in later years, Spruance, Stanley & Co. consisted of just John Spruance and Charles W Fore. The company had outlets in San Fancisco and Sacramento and were importers and wholesalers. They were wiped out by the 1906 earthquake.

Brand names used by this company include: "Kentucky Favorite", "O.P.T. Whiskey", and "Sunflower Pennsylvania Rye."

Company name timeline:
J & J Spruance (1867-1871), Spruance, Stanley & Co. (1872-1906)

Address timeline:
415 Front (1867-1871), 410 Front (1872-1906)
